‘Good things take time’ – Fieldays Ag Art Wear entry deadlines extended

It’s not too late to create a masterpiece for the Ag Art Wear Competition with entry deadlines extended until early June.

Fieldays organisers are pleased with the interest in the competition with a range of entries received including strong representation from Australian designers and artists. “Good things take time,” says Fieldays Communications Advisor, Nicole Foster. “By popular demand we are extending the deadline for entries into the Ag Art Wear Competition allowing creators to put their very best work forward”.

Other Fieldays competitions and activities closing soon are:

* Fieldays Innovations Centre Equipment and Inventions, 18 May 2007

* Fieldays Rural Bachelor of the Year, 19 May 2007

* Fieldays Sonic Arts Challenge, 25 May 2007

* Fieldays Possum Fur Fashion Design Award, 1 June 2007

* Fieldays Waikato Draught / Wiremark Fencing Championships, 1 June 2007

* Fieldays National Tractor Pull Competition, 1 June 2007

* Fieldays Innovations Centre “What’s your problem” ideas competition, 8 June 2007

* And prepurchase Fieldays tickets online or by phone before 1 June 2007 to go into the
draw for a Suzuki quad bike.

Get an information and entry forms from www.fieldays.co.nz or phone 07 843 4499. Fieldays will be held 13 – 16 June 2007 at Mystery Creek Events Centre, south of Hamilton.
